#bae6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bae6ed is composed of 72.9% red, 90.2%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.5%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 188.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 82.9%. #bae6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75cddb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#bae6ed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bae6ed has RGB values of R:186, G:230,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12248813.

Hex triplet bae6ed #bae6ed
RGB Decimal 186, 230, 237 rgb(186,230,237)
RGB Percent 72.9, 90.2, 92.9 rgb(72.9%,90.2%,92.9%)
CMYK 22, 3, 0, 7
HSL 188.2°, 58.6, 82.9 hsl(188.2,58.6%,82.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 188.2°, 21.5, 92.9
Web Safe ccffff #ccffff
CIE-LAB 88.517, -12.65, -8.099
XYZ 63.829, 73.145, 90.872
xyY 0.28, 0.321, 73.145
CIE-LCH 88.517, 15.02, 212.63
CIE-LUV 88.517, -22.725, -10.523
Hunter-Lab 85.525, -16.451, -3.129
Binary 10111010, 11100110, 11101101

Shades and Tints of #bae6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bae6ed is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#dadada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d4dcde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e0dee9 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ebdaf2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#bfe5f6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d2e1ea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d9def0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bde5f3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
